Bilinear Bochner-Riesz Means for Grushin Operators

Analysis of PDEs 2025-06-17 v2

Abstract

This paper is devoted to the study of Lp1×Lp2L^{p_1} \times L^{p_2} to LpL^{p} boundedness of the bilinear Bochner-Riesz mean Bα\mathcal{B}^{\alpha} associated with the Grushin operator L=Δxx2Δx\mathcal{L} = -\Delta_{x'} - |x'|^2 \Delta_{x''} on Rd1×Rd2\mathbb{R}^{d_1} \times \mathbb{R}^{d_2}. Our result almost resembles the corresponding Euclidean results, where the Euclidean dimension in the smoothness threshold is replaced by the topological dimension dd of the underlying space, except at few cases.
